Description of technology
The Biogas Technology (BT) offers an efficient way of biomass utilization. It involves anaerobic fermentation of organic materials such as animal dung, agricultural wastes, aquatic weeds etc. to produce a methane rich fuel gas and a value added organic fertilizer. Thus, it has considerable potential for providing fuel and fertilizer besides being a system for waste recycling, prevention of pollution and ecological imbalance and improvement of sanitary conditions in the rural areas. A typical biogas plant consists of a digester where the anaerobic fermentation takes place, a gasholder for collecting the biogas, the input-output units for feeding the influent and storing the effluent respectively and a gas distribution system.

Total investment
Based on the 2009 prices the biogas plants may cost (including all these costs) 3m3 biogas plants cost ~200-300 $ 5m3 biogas plant cost ~300-500 $
